Problem #1: Write a program that prompts the user to enter a client's account ID, then displays the name of the branch in which this client has an account. The account id is a positive integer composed of 6 digits. - An account belongs to Beirut branch if its id starts with 11 - An account belongs to Akkar branch if its id starts with 12 - An account id is invalid if it is not composed of 6 digits or it does not start with 11 or 12 Sample run 1: Enter your ID: 114587 It is Beirut Branch Sample run 2: Enter your ID: 3245 Invalid ID Sample run 3: Enter your ID: 311245 Invalid ID
